Mid-Century Modern Table by Sergio Mazza For Domus Competition - Italy

About the Item

Important table, black steel legs with adjustable polished solid brass feet, original formica on top. Design: Sergio Mazza for Domus Competition 1956, Italy, 1956. Bibliography: Domus 8336 11/1957.

For the history buffs here, it goes…Sergio Rodrigues started working in the 1950s when the foundations of modern Brazilian architecture were already laid out, yet furniture design was still nascent. Rodrigues set himself the task of designing furniture that was both truly Brazilian and modernist at the same time. Over the course of his career, he accomplished this task by defining a robust, modern, and pure language reflected in his work.
